    The last five minutes of the drive to Vanilla Hills starts framing the experience you'll have when you get there. It's no ordinary road -- it's a picturesque stone lane that hints there's something special to look forward to. What a nice facility! The reception area is brand new and we were lucky to get a tour of the huge, new, sparkling clean kitchen. A new lounge area is in the works and we'll definitely make use of that on our next visit. The food is exceptional with a menu co-created by Claudia (an owner) and Felix, a hot young chef with loads of talent. Restaurant staff were cheerful, efficient and made great recommendations. We stayed in the 2-bedroom Villa which had great views out toward the river. It was spotless, presented nicely, and very private. I appreciate the way Vanilla Hills focuses on quality -- quality everything -- without making pretentious claims and promises. And without a pretentious price tag. It's charming, welcoming, relaxed, well designed, and well maintained. In the hills between San Ignacio and Bullet Tree Falls, this would be a great central base for touring Cayo. Or do what we did, and just vegetate.

We were treated as treasured friends from the very first moment and it only got better from there. We stayed in one of the two gorgeous “treehouses” nestled in the jungle. What a romantic place! Our treehouse had floor-to-ceiling glass on 3 sides (with adjustable louvers & drapes), a comfortable king bed, glowing hardwood floors, air conditioning, ceiling fan, microwave, refrigerator, stoneware, coffee station, ample electrical outlets, room-sized safe, hammock, fresh flowers…and a very private luxurious open-air shower. Birds and butterflies were constant companions. There are additional delights, but I’ll let you be happily surprised. The stunning infinity edge pool and grounds were pristine. So was our treehouse and the beautiful open-air Vanilla Hills café. Daily housekeeping allowed us to return to an immaculate suite after long hot days of travel, hiking, and caving. The food is incredible – and incredibly healthy. Everything is made fresh, including the bread. There is no need to eat anywhere else – and you will not want to. Everything was perfectly prepared and exquisitely presented. On our last night I wasn’t feeling well after a too-hot trip to Guatemala’s Tikal. Our server, always kind, thoughtfully had a bland dish specially prepared that I was able to enjoy. A few hints: Don’t trust Google Maps! At the time of this writing, routes the unwary traveler is routed down what can most diplomatically be described as a cow path. The “magenta line” will eventually take you to Vanilla Hills – but call or write ahead for the best directions (they are easy). Don’t trust Google in San Ignacio, either – it will send you the wrong direction down one-way streets and bridges! Book directly with Vanilla Hills via their website or another channel and not via a third-party site such as Expedia. Expedia works – we did it -- but booking directly with Claudia is superior. Allow an extra day during your adventures to simply relax at Vanilla Hills, including around the pool. We made the mistake of not doing this and remain regretful.
